Overview

Vipera ammodytes venom, derived from the nose-horned viper, is a complex biological mixture being investigated for its potential in oncology, particularly for the treatment of malignant melanoma. Proteomic analysis of the venom reveals a high abundance of Phospholipases A2, C-type lectins, and snake venom metalloproteinases (SVMPs), which contribute to its cytotoxic, anti-proliferative, and tumor-inhibiting properties. In preclinical in vitro studies, the venom has demonstrated significant cytotoxicity against various melanoma cell lines (M001, Me501, and A375) and has shown a potent chemosensitising effect when combined with cisplatin. This synergy is especially notable in cisplatin-resistant cell lines, where the venom enhances cell mortality by up to 40%. The venom's mechanism involves inducing morphological changes and selective targeting of cancer cells, positioning it as a potential therapeutic adjuvant for advanced or metastatic melanoma.
